DESCRIPTION:[vc_row content_placement=”middle”][vc_column][vc_empty_space height=”20px”][vc_column_text css=””]\nAugust 12, 2026 @ 1:00 PM Eastern Time\n[/vc_column_text][vc_column_text css=””]\nSpecial Guest: Nicole Pottroff (Koprince, McCall, Pottroff LLC)\n[/vc_column_text][vc_column_text css=””][/vc_column_text][/vc_column][/vc_row][vc_row content_placement=”middle”][vc_column][vc_column_text css=””]Two major developments could dramatically reshape the future of federal contracting for 8(a) and Women-Owned Small Business (WOSB) firms — and both are moving right now.\nIn this episode of GovCon Roundup Live, hosts Carroll Bernard and Steven Koprince are joined by special guest Nicole Pottroff, federal contracting attorney and equity partner at Koprince McCall Pottroff LLC, to unpack a proposed SBA rule and pending legislation that could significantly change both programs.\nWhat we’ll cover:[/vc_column_text][/vc_column][/vc_row][vc_row content_placement=”middle”][vc_column width=”1/6″][vc_icon icon_fontawesome=”fa fa-solid fa-check” color=”juicy_pink” align=”right” css=””][/vc_column][vc_column width=”5/6″][vc_column_text css=””]The SBA’s June 2026 proposed rule — eliminating the rebuttable presumption of social disadvantage for individually owned 8(a) firms and replacing it with a uniform, evidence-based standard. What evidence will SBA accept? How could it affect new applicants? And could current participants have to prove continued eligibility at their annual review?[/vc_column_text][/vc_column][/vc_row][vc_row content_placement=”middle”][vc_column width=”1/6″][vc_icon icon_fontawesome=”fa fa-solid fa-check” color=”juicy_pink” align=”right” css=””][/vc_column][vc_column width=”5/6″][vc_column_text css=””]The Ending Discrimination in Government Contracting Act (H.R. 8511 / S. 4390) — legislation that, if enacted, would eliminate federal contracting preferences and goals based on race, ethnicity, or sex, potentially dismantling the statutory foundations of both the 8(a) and WOSB programs.[/vc_column_text][/vc_column][/vc_row][vc_row content_placement=”middle”][vc_column width=”1/6″][vc_icon icon_fontawesome=”fa fa-solid fa-check” color=”juicy_pink” align=”right” css=””][/vc_column][vc_column width=”5/6″][vc_column_text css=””]The bigger picture — the latest developments on the 8(a) application backlog and the 8(a) & WOSB program audit, and what all of this means for certified firms, companies considering certification, and the broader small business community.[/vc_column_text][/vc_column][/vc_row][vc_row][vc_column][vc_column_text css=””]We’ll break down the legal and regulatory risks, the compliance challenges ahead, opportunities for advocacy, and the practical steps you can take now to prepare for whatever comes next.\nWhether you’re 8(a)- or WOSB-certified, weighing certification, or simply trying to stay ahead of a shifting landscape, this is a conversation you won’t want to miss.\nJoin us live on August 12, 2026 — free to attend.
